Output 679d8413dab33c0e6112817c6162cbab1f8185e9a44de8493c6bf6b1f0df299d:1

value
134889054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a4ba94536bfbad10ab92cec1db810ec5df14f0 OP_EQUAL
address
MBEuttttbQ2LjrVTWhydB8NSpoSijmbPDm
transaction
679d8413dab33c0e6112817c6162cbab1f8185e9a44de8493c6bf6b1f0df299d
spent
true